Práctica 5. Uso Del Lenguaje DML
-
Upload
anonymous-agqqftizzt -
Category
Documents
-
view
7 -
download
0
description
Transcript of Práctica 5. Uso Del Lenguaje DML
Universidad Autónoma del Estado de México
Centro Universitario UAEM Atlacomulco
Licenciatura en Informática Administrativa
Bases de Datos Relacionales
Práctica 5. Uso del lenguaje DML
Docente: LIA. Elizabeth Evangelista Nava
Dicente: Ruben Hernández Mendoza
No. De Lista: 15
Grupo:
LIA I9
Atlacomulco México a 20 de octubre de 2015
Introducción
Es importante que la parte teórica se lleve a la práctica por lo que el dicente
aplicara sus conocimientos del lenguaje de manipulación de datos, aplicando
los comandos que se tienen en esta tipo le lenguaje a su base de datos
biblioteca donde se encuentran las entidades que se ocuparan para esta
práctica.
Propósito:
El discente hará uso de las sentencias INSERT, DELETE y UPDATE utilizando
la Base de Datos BIBLIOTECA.
Alcances:
Uso en línea de comandos de sentencias insert, update y delete.
Requerimientos:
Equipo de cómputo, Sistema operativo Windows, Oracle Database 11g XE.
Para poner en práctica las sentencias del lenguaje de manipulación de datos
seguiremos los siguientes pasos:
Actividad A.1
1.- Primero ingresar a nuestro espacio de trabajo una vez en el inicio ubicarse
en la solapa SQL Workshop donde al desplegarse las opciones encontraremos
SQL Commands donde damos un clic como en la figura 1.1.
Figura 1.1 Solapa SQL Workshop
2.- Una vez que ingresamos al modo grafico de comandos escribimos la
primera sentencia SQL como en la figura 1.2. En este caso Ingresaremos datos
a las entidad LIBRO por lo cual usaremos las siguiente sentencia insert into
PRESTATARIO values ('Miguel Angel Becerril Arias', 'Ixtlahuaca', 'Ixtlahuaca',
'1001');., en la figura 1.1 vemos la sentencia una vez este escrita bien damos
en run y en la parte inferior debe aparecer que se ha insertado el dato a la
entidad. Así hasta la figura 1.9 ingresaremos 8 registros.
Figura 1.2 Insertar valores a la entidad LIBRO.
En las siguientes figuras se mostrara los otros 7 registros de la entidad LIBRO.
Figura 1.3
Figura 1.4
Figura 1.5
Figura 1.6
Figura 1.7
Figura 1.8 Tabla actualizada con los datos ingresados.
Actividad A.2
Inserta en la tabla o entidad el LIBRO titulado “Lógica Difusa” y en la tabla o
entidad PRESTATARIO en el campo nombre del prestatario Ricardo Cardenas
Cardenas, completa el registro (fila) con la información que considere
necesaria.
3.- Escribir la sentencia insert into PRSTATARIO value (‘Ricardo Cardenas
Cardenas’), ‘Atlacomulco’, ‘Atlacomulco’, ‘1009’; como en la figura 1.9. En la
figura 1.10 podemos visualizar que se ingresa el registro “Lógica Difusa” en la
entidad LIBRO.
Figura 1.9 Insertar nuevo valor entidad PRESTATARIO.
Figura 1.10 Insertar registro “Lógica Difusa”
Actividad B.1: Elimina de la entidad libro todas aquellas cuyo nombre sea
Lógica Difusa.
4.- Escribir la sentencia delete LIBRO where TIT_LIB='Lógica Difusa'; como en
la figura 1.12. En la figura 1.11 se muestra la existencia del libro “Lógica
Difusa”. En la figura 1.13 se puede ver la selección de registros de la entidad
Libro sin la existencia del libro “Lógica Difusa”.
Figura 1.11 Entidad LIBRO (Registro del libro lógica difusa).
Figura 1.12 Eliminar el registro “Lógica Difusa”.
Figura 1.13 Selección de los registros de la entidad LIBRO.
Actividad c.1:
Actualiza todos los registros del libro cuyo editor sea MC-Graw Hill y
sustitúyelo por triunfador.
5.- Para actulizar los registros de le entidad LIBRO escribimos la siguiente
sentencia Update LIBRO set NOM_EDI='triufador' where NOM_EDI='MC-Graw
Hill'; en la figura 1.15 podemos ver aplicada la sentencia SQL. En la figura 1.14
podemos ver que existe el registro del nombre de la editorial MC-Graw Hill.
Figura 1.14 Muestra el registro del nombre de editorial MC-Graw Hill.
Figura 1.14 Actualizar los registros de la entidad LIBRO.
Figura 1.15 Selección de los registros de la entidad LIBRO.
Conclusión:
Es importante que el alumno comprenda e interprete para que se usan cada
tipo de lenguaje SQL y sus sentencias por lo que el poner en práctica estas
sentencias fortalecerá los conocimientos del dicente y permitirá tenga un
panorama más amplio de las diferentes maneras de interactuar con las
entidades, registros y otros atributos y características del sistema gestor de
base de datos Oracle.
Referencias:
LIA. Elizabeth Evangelista Nava, I. J. (2015). Manual de práctica básica con
SQL. Atlacomulco, México.: Universidad Autónoma del Estado de
México.